The Great House was a gracious, laid-back hotel on a beautiful white sand beach at Rendezvous Bay. There were few guest this time of year so we often had the beach to ourselves. A few days a week, a catamarran full of tourists would come over from St. Martin to enjoy our beach and eat at the restaurant. The Caribe Restaurant was across the yard and served excellent food at reasonable prices when compared to other places on this island. We also tried several other restaurants on the island and meals were good to excellent. We rented a car which was very helpful in exploring this small island and getting to other beaches where we could snorkel through the coral reefs of enchanting colorful fish. Locals were friendly, respectful, and helpful. They came to our beach early each morning for a swim before work and again at the end of the day. We took the ferry to St. Martin one day. The ride was very bumpy across he sea and should not be made on a full stomach! St. Martin' s town of Margot was busy with some lovely French sidewalk cafes. We caught a bus to the Dutch side of the island and saw the sights. We were glad to get back to Anguila were life moves at a much slower pace. If you're a shopper, this is not the island for you, but we found it a great place to unwind. There was always a nice breeze, no bugs, and a spot under the palms to sit and read or watch the birds and visitors.

Ok, I want you read this review carefully. If will help you if/when you decide to stay here and might set the stage for a great trip or a disappointed one. First, let me say that we have traveled around the world and have stayed in locations ranging from one star to five star. So, I feel qualified to offer this opinion. Before you decide where you want to stay in Anguilla, it is critical to decide what is most important. If it's beach location, you CANNOT, I repeat, CANNOT get much better than this! Great House is directly on beautiful Rendevous Bay (reported to be the 2nd or 3rd best beach in the world) at a fraction of the cost of the well known Cuisinart resort next door. You will feel like you have your own private beach. Also, bring or buy insect roll-on while on the island. If lodging and ameneties are MOST important to the travelers, then you probably want to avoid Great House. The rooms are bungalow style that are separated by shared doors. They have A/C, ceiling fans, cable TV, iron, small desk, and a small fridge. However, they are a bit dated and need updating. I will admit that after checking-in, my wife was not happy. However, after one day and a little additional cleaning, she was fine. My best advice is do not try and measure this property by what you may be used to in larger US cities or Brand Name Hotels. As our friends reminded us "Remember that this is the Caribbean". Actually, by the end of the week, we were talking about when we would return to Great House. Did I mention it's proximity to the beach!!! The onsite restaurant and bar was great and offered a open outdoor atmosphere next to the beach. The staff was great and whom we now call friends. In summary, if you are coming to Anguilla and want a true Caribbean experience, feel, and beach location, at a fraction of the cost, this is the place to stay. If you want big resort feel, spa, fitness centers, private cabanas, and pampering, then there are plenty of other well know resorts on the island. The true test for any location is whether you would come back to stay. Let me say that "yes, I would."

Anguilla Great House Beach Resort places you next to Rendezvous Bay Beach and within a mile (2 km) of Cuisinart Resort Golf Course. This 35-room hotel welcomes guests with a restaurant and conveniences like an outdoor pool and free in-room WiFi.


Dining

For your convenience, a full breakfast is available for a fee. This hotel has a restaurant that's perfect for a leisurely bite to eat.


Rooms

Guests can expect to find free WiFi and flat-screen TVs with cable channels. Bathrooms offer hair dryers and free toiletries. Patios, refrigerators, and ceiling fans are also standard.


Property features

Guests of Anguilla Great House Beach Resort have access to an outdoor pool, a gym, and free WiFi in public areas. There's free parking and limo/town car service. Front-desk staff can answer questions 24/7, and assist with tours or tickets, luggage storage, and dry cleaning/laundry. Other amenities at this beach hotel include conference space, a business center, and a terrace.
